Business Enterprise Exclusion Precludes Coverage, Wisconsin Majority Affirms

Mealey's (July 6, 2016, 1:25 PM EDT) -- MADISON, Wis. — A majority of the Wisconsin Supreme Court on June 30 affirmed that a professional liability errors and omissions insurance policy’s business enterprise exclusion bars coverage for six underlying lawsuits against a professional trustee insured, finding that the insured relied on a “stunted strand of law” in arguing that the insurer has a duty to defend (David M. Marks v. Houston Casualty Co., et al., No. 2013AP2756, Wis. Sup.; 2016 Wisc. LEXIS 162)....
